Transaction 31384e21e561ca3c37b9a416dda52aa5f828197ccb4532a87bcbc48949df0969

1 Input
2 Outputs
  • 31384e21e561ca3c37b9a416dda52aa5f828197ccb4532a87bcbc48949df0969:0
  • value  196977
    address  165931uYVw3BPpRVzrhswM2p4mLRjYgvuj
  • 31384e21e561ca3c37b9a416dda52aa5f828197ccb4532a87bcbc48949df0969:1
  • value  1078
    address  3KmhJ4rqcA2vm7c9x7w2qvXuNx3CjsTiyu